Ceasar Salad French Style

Ingredients

Serves: 2

For the Salad

  • 1 large head of romaine lettuce
  • 1 ounce grated Parmesan
  • 1 handful crispy duck crackling

For the Dressing

  • 1 teaspoon dijon mustard
  • 3 tablespoons red wine vinegar
  • ½ cup ext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 teaspoons freshly chopped mixed herbs
  • ¼ cup creme fraiche
  • 1 handful duck crackling

Method

  1. Remove tough outer leaves of the lettuce. Slice off the end then rinse out the dirt and impurities in cold running water. Pat dry and slice the leaves across at about 1 inch intervals.
  2. Using the large-holed side of the grater, grate the Parmasen cheese.
  3. Toss the lettuce with the cheese, a handful of cracklings and a generous amount of dressing.
  4. To serve, add on top ¼ cup of salad croutons.

Additional Information

Do not use supermarket powdered Parmasen cheese!
